Current Status of Penn and Teller

As of the latest public records, neither Penn Jillette nor Teller have passed away. Both remain active in entertainment, business, and public commentary. Their ongoing projects continue to generate interest among fans and investors alike. For the most accurate updates, you can check their official channels and reputable news sources like Forbes.

Rumors about the duo's death occasionally surface online, but these are consistently debunked by reliable outlets. Their public appearances, social media activity, and business filings confirm they are alive and well. Understanding the facts helps separate verified information from viral misinformation.
